The Western has always been an inspiring genre for fashion, and this 2022 season is brimming with it. All the major fashion houses are embracing this ever-recurring style. In this new take, it moves away from romantic Prairie House dresses and toward more adventurous and wild looks, thus embodying the true spirit of the American Wild West.

 At Ana Faustino Atelier, we’ve embraced international trends and participated in a very unique and different editorial. To achieve this, we moved from our boutique in Barcelona’s Eixample district to a riding stable in the middle of a rural setting (an unusual setting for a wedding dress shoot).  

 Marusia, the stylist, managed to create a setting reminiscent of that distant, undiscovered territory, down to the last detail. To achieve this, she combined rustic furniture with materials from the stables themselves. The filter in the image, used by Natalia in the photographs, gave the entire session that golden, earthy tone.  

 We wanted to create a bridal style that doesn’t conform to the traditional rules for bridal looks. We broke away from the classic and conventional to move toward sexier and more daring designs. The designs feature bold lines, fitted to the body or flowing, allowing for freedom of movement.  

The dresses are made with “rebordé” lace, a fabric composed of a thick thread that outlines shapes, in this case geometric. This technique creates a very distinctive and striking look. The necklines are exaggerated and complemented by wide, flowing sleeves, achieving a distinctive style. The skirts, with exaggerated flare thanks to the wide godets, allow for free and fluid movement.

 The two-piece top and skirt set is the perfect combination for this bride who wants something different and more natural. The buttoned cropped top with puffed sleeves and a V-neckline gives a fresh, yet feminine and sexy effect. The top pairs perfectly with the slit silk crepe skirt.
